KEBA/LTI SO24.012.6N40.00U2.1 - ServoOne Junior DCR-i1 Drive

The KEBA/LTI SO24.012.6N40.00U2.1 is a robust and highly reliable automation module designed to meet the demanding requirements of the power industry, petrochemical sector, and general automation fields. Engineered with precision, this model offers exceptional input/output capacity, durability, and performance, making it a preferred choice for critical industrial applications where precision and uptime are paramount. At its core, the KEBA/LTI SO24.012.6N40.00U2.1 features an extensive I/O configuration capable of handling a broad range of digital and analog signals. This versatility enables seamless integration with complex automation systems, supporting up to 24 inputs and 12 outputs with high-speed switching capabilities. Its input channels are designed to accommodate both voltage and current signals, ensuring compatibility with diverse sensor types commonly used in power plants and petrochemical processing units. The output stages deliver strong and stable signals, suitable for controlling actuators, relays, and other industrial devices with minimal latency. Durability is a hallmark of the SO24.012.6N40.00U2.1. Its rugged construction ensures resistance to harsh environmental conditions, including extreme temperatures, humidity, and electromagnetic interference. The module undergoes rigorous testing to comply with industrial standards, guaranteeing long-term reliability and minimal maintenance requirements. This robustness translates into reduced downtime and enhanced operational efficiency, critical factors in power generation and chemical processing plants where continuous operation is essential. 


Performance-wise, the SO24.012.6N40.00U2.1 excels with rapid response times and precise signal processing. Its advanced internal architecture supports real-time data acquisition and control, facilitating complex automation tasks such as fault detection, process optimization, and safety monitoring. Compared to earlier models like the KEBA/LTI SO84:012:1030:0000:2, the SO24.012.6N40.00U2.1 offers improved input density and faster communication interfaces, enabling more sophisticated control strategies and enhanced system scalability. In practical applications, the KEBA/LTI SO24.012.6N40.00U2.1 stands out in power industry settings where reliable monitoring and control of electrical substations and generation equipment are vital. Its ability to process diverse analog and digital signals makes it ideal for managing transformers, circuit breakers, and switchgear. Similarly, in the petrochemical industry, this module effectively handles process control tasks, including pressure regulation, temperature monitoring, and safety interlocks, ensuring operational safety and compliance with stringent regulatory standards. The model’s adaptability extends to general automation scenarios, such as factory floor automation and building management systems, where it integrates seamlessly with other KEBA/LTI automation products to enhance overall system efficiency.
